Notes:
- Questions in Tsalagi are formed with question words (who, what when, where etc) just like they are in english.
- Tsalagi also uses question suffixes. These suffixes are always added to the end of the first word in the sentence.
Question Words Question Suffixes
What -- gado; gado yusdi; do usdi
What / Which -- gado iyusdi; do iysdi Where -- gatsv; hadlv Who -- kago iyusdi When -- hvgaiyv Why -- gadohv; dohno How Much -- hvgaiga |
Question suffixes are added to the first word in a sentence.
-sgo -s -tsu -ge |
Examples
kagiyusdi gawohina? <who is it speaking?>
gatsv hwigti? <where are you going?>
tsalagisgo hiwoniha? <do you speak cherokee?>
osigwotsu? <how are you?>
gilsgo hia? <is this a dog?>
